A normal sofa is comprised of individual sections that are used solely for sitting, while the sectional sleeper features an integrated bed that you can pull out whenever needed. The difference between the two types of sofas is not obvious however, it's essential to consider the way a sectional sofa will be used prior to buying it.
A sectional sofa can be used as a bed or seat. Select a sofa made of high-quality materials for a long couch with chaise-lasting product. A solid wood frame that is kiln-dried for extra durability, is the best choice. The cushioning must be soft and durable, such as high-resiliency or foam with feathers and fibers to give a bit more. If you have pets or children, sleeping sofas that are easy to clean will help avoid accidents.

What is the difference between an out-of-seat sofa and a sectional bed?
A regular sofa is designed as a seating area. A sectional sofa sleeper features an inbuilt mattress that can be pulled out when needed. A sectional sleeper is usually larger than a pull-out sofa due to the extra space on the side where the bed can fold out.
There are a variety of sleepers that are sectional, such as futons, convertible chaises, and storage sectional sleepers. Each type has its own benefits and is best suited to an individual situation. For instance, a futon sectional sleeper comes with an unfolding mattress that is located at the top of the sofa while a convertible chaise sectional has a bed that converts from the back of the couch. A sleeper that is storage comes with a hidden compartment that can be used for storing bedding and other items.
